Abstract
The authors have applied statistical analysis to mineralogical composition and trace-element data of samples from several quarries known to be mined by the Romans. Rock from these quarries was distributed throughout the Roman Empire, and Roman population patterns can be used to determine the origin of the artefacts. XRD and XRF analyses of 11 marbles and other rocks mined by the Romans are presented.-P.Br.
